Norris Rail Cranes | C. Norris Manfacturing – Norris Manufacturing
Product Details: C. Norris Rail Crane, a hydraulic rail crane designed for versatility and efficiency in material handling on rail systems.
Technical Parameters:
– Weight: 234,000 lbs.
– Reach: Up to 70′
Application Scenarios:
– Handling materials in rail cars
– Construction and maintenance of rail systems
Pros:
– Independent drive motors for optimal traction
– Operator friendly with shorter training periods
Cons:
– High initial investment cost
– Requires maintenance for hydraulic systems
Crane Rail – L.B. Foster
Product Details: L.B. Foster Company offers a complete line of crane rail systems and accessories for a variety of industrial applications.
Technical Parameters:
– Crane rail systems available in weights of 12-lb. up to 175-lb.
– Lengths generally available: 30 ft., 33 ft., 39 ft., 40 ft., 60 ft., and 78 ft.
Application Scenarios:
– Overhead cranes
– Gantry cranes
Pros:
– High quality and performance solutions
– Wide range of weights and lengths available
Cons:
– Limited information on specific applications
– Potentially high cost for specialized systems
Railway Cranes – Railquip
Product Details: The world’s strongest telescopic Railway Crane with a lifting capacity of up to 172 tons.
Technical Parameters:
– Lifting capacity: up to 172 tons
– Power sources: diesel engines, electric motors, or a combination
Application Scenarios:
– Railway underpasses
– Railway bridges
– Substations
– Trackside railway structures
Pros:
– High lifting capacity for heavy-duty applications
– Advanced maneuverability for tight spaces
Cons:
– Requires regular maintenance and inspections
– Operational limitations based on rail track type

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
What types of railway cranes do manufacturers produce?
Manufacturers typically produce various types of railway cranes, including mobile cranes, stationary cranes, and specialized cranes designed for specific tasks like maintenance or construction. Each type is engineered to meet the unique demands of railway operations, ensuring safety and efficiency.
How do I choose the right railway crane for my needs?
To choose the right railway crane, consider factors like the weight capacity, reach, and the specific tasks you need it for. It’s also important to evaluate the crane’s compatibility with your existing equipment and the environment in which it will operate.
What safety standards do railway crane manufacturers follow?
Railway crane manufacturers adhere to strict safety standards set by industry regulations. These include guidelines for design, construction, and operation to ensure that cranes are safe for use in railway environments, minimizing risks to operators and workers.
Can I customize a railway crane for my specific requirements?
Yes, many manufacturers offer customization options for railway cranes. You can work with them to tailor features such as lifting capacity, attachments, and control systems to meet your specific operational needs and preferences.
What is the typical lead time for ordering a railway crane?
The lead time for ordering a railway crane can vary based on the manufacturer and the complexity of the crane. Generally, it can take anywhere from a few weeks to several months, so it’s best to plan ahead and discuss timelines with the manufacturer.
